Quick question for folks. I fish in a kayak and really struggle to find a way to secure my 10' rod that has a rear reel seat. The normal rod holders on my milk crate don't work, so I am wondering if any of you have found a solution. I love the rod and want to use it, but I am afraid I might lose it.
That’s why I didn’t buy any rear seats for same problem. You could attach a leash or small float to it or lay it across kayak using rod holders like this article on rigging a kayak.
